- static uint32_t unin_get_config_reg(uint32_t reg, uint32_t addr)
- {
- uint32_t retval;
- if (reg & (1u << 31)) {
- /* XXX OpenBIOS compatibility hack */
- retval = reg | (addr & 3);
- } else if (reg & 1) {
- /* CFA1 style */
- retval = (reg & ~7u) | (addr & 7);
- } else {
- uint32_t slot, func;
- /* Grab CFA0 style values */
- slot = ffs(reg & 0xfffff800) - 1;
- func = (reg >> 8) & 7;
- /* ... and then convert them to x86 format */
- /* config pointer */
- retval = (reg & (0xff - 7)) | (addr & 7);
- /* slot */
- retval |= slot << 11;
- /* fn */
- retval |= func << 8;
- }
- UNIN_DPRINTF("Converted config space accessor %08x/%08x -> %08x\n",
- reg, addr, retval);
- return retval;
- }
